Transaction 61e398ffd6039c62ec8fee3f5a6696a027632e71c94462371f966283342340df
1 Input
1 Output
-
61e398ffd6039c62ec8fee3f5a6696a027632e71c94462371f966283342340df:0
- value
- 141376
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b9a85f6fe3b30368b7e0de392d2b42fb4323b0c
- address
- bc1qdwdgtah78vcrdzm7ph3e9545976rywcvza7qeq